3 Steps to Automate Your Real Estate Follow-Up System

Collecting leads is the key to your success as a real estate agent. However, leads alone will not suffice. Now that you've optimized your sales funnel for obtaining leads, the secret to real success is following up with them. Of course, you already know this.

Following up is a time-consuming and sometimes discouraging task. But what if you could take the hassle out of this process and give yourself more time to focus on your objectives?

In reality, this is rather simple. When done correctly, it will guide your consumers from an interest in your services to a transaction at the perfect moment for them. Let's look at how to put together a successful follow-up system.

Segment Your Audience

In a previous article, we discussed how to identify who your target audience is. Your first step should be to determine the intent of the person visiting your website. Are they selling or purchasing? Is it their first time looking for real estate property? Are they seeking to acquire a home or a commercial building?

Make it simple for them to respond by including a specific call to action on relevant articles. If possible, include essential fields on your contact forms. However, you don't want to annoy them! You have a chance now to get their information and their intentions. Once you've obtained both of these things, you have struck gold

Target your Specific Segments

Many autoresponders enable you to target emails based on the recipient's action. This makes it simple to tailor follow-up communications for each person. Want to send a follow-up email to those who clicked a particular link? Make a segment and send it off. Do you want to re-engage with folks who haven't opened? This is easy to do with the right tools and systems in place.

To get more information about a specific customer or visitor, you may dig even further in Wishpond and identify exact user actions. For example, using a home buyer's scenario, you may see which properties they looked at on your site. Find out what type of property they prefer by looking at their patterns of response. This may assist you in providing them with the ideal house, possibly even on the first follow-up.

Another approach to categorize your list is by what they don't buy. If a subscriber has been on a directory where you're advertising your top-level properties and has yet to make a purchase, it may be too costly or not the right fit right now. Move this audience to an autoresponder series or even a simple drip campaign that informs them about alternatives at a lower price. They will turn to you when the time comes to take action, as long as you keep your services and expertise fresh in their minds in a non-intrusive manner.

Create the Follow-Up

All of these strategies will assist you in understanding your target audience better. Keep track of your stats. Open and click rates are important. Pay attention to the advertisements that work, as well as those that don't work. You'll be better equipped to target specific segments of your audience based on their goals once you have the information on hand.

Send automated emails to leads with a specific purpose and a drip campaign that sends out messages at regular intervals. Make sure they're packed with useful information, although brief.

While these techniques are effective at producing more leads than you would have on your own, nothing compares to the personal touch. These strategies are no substitute for a genuine phone conversation in which you may have a hot lead. Work in the text message and social media efforts as well, and you'll be sure to smash it!
